Borinic acid, dipropyl-, butyl ester, also known as butyl dipropylborinate, is an organoborinic compound with the chemical formula C9H21BO2. It is a colorless liquid that is soluble in organic solvents and has a molecular weight of 172.07 g/mol. Borinic acid, dipropyl-, butyl ester is synthesized by the reaction of dipropylborinic acid with butanol in the presence of a catalyst, such as sulfuric acid. Butyl dipropylborinate is primarily used as a reagent in organic synthesis, particularly in the formation of carbon-carbon bonds through the hydroboration reaction. It is also employed as a reducing agent and a ligand in various chemical processes. Due to its reactivity and potential applications, butyl dipropylborinate is an important intermediate in the field of organic chemistry.

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 3578-40-3 includes 7 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 4 digits, 3,5,7 and 8 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 4 and 0 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 3578-40:
(6*3)+(5*5)+(4*7)+(3*8)+(2*4)+(1*0)=103
103 % 10 = 3
So 3578-40-3 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Reactions of Acetophenone Dibutyl Acetal with Dipropylchloroborane and Trimethylchlorosilane

Bagdasaryan, G. B.,Sarkisova, E. A.,Indzhikyan, M. G.

, p. 354 - 356 (2007/10/03)

Acetophenone dibutyl acetal reacts with dipropylchloroborane or trimethylchlorosilane, yielding 1,3,5-triphenylbenzene.The reaction is also successful in the presence of catalytic amounts of these electrophiles.
